Arc fault circuit detector device detecting pulse width modulation of arc noise

1. An arc fault detecting device for protecting an electric power line comprising:

  • a sensor coupled to the power line for detecting broad band arc noise caused by an arc fault in the electric power line;

    a detector connected to the sensor for generating a pulse having a time width proportional to the time during which a random pulse of broad band arc noise generated by the arc fault in the electric power line is present;

    a counter connected to the detector;

    a first memory for storing a value proportional to the width of a present pulse;

    a second memory for storing a value proportional to the width of a prior pulse;

    a comparator;

    an output connected to the comparator which indicates if an arc fault has occurred;

    in which the comparator compares the value in the first memory to the value in the second memory and increments a counter if the difference is greater than a first predetermined value, and outputs an arc fault detection signal when the counter value is greater than or equal to a second predetermined value.
